在现代软件开发中,智能体(Agent)的应用越来越广泛。通过智能体的协同工作,可以显著提高软件开发的效率和质量。本文将探讨智能体如何协同工作,以及它们在软件开发过程中的具体应用场景。
智能体协同工作是指多个智能体相互协作,共同完成复杂的任务。每个智能体都有其特定的功能和职责,并通过通信协议进行信息交换和任务协调。这种协同工作模式能够充分利用各个智能体的优势,实现任务的高效处理和优化。智能体协同工作的好处包括:
1、提高工作效率:多个智能体可处理不同任务,减少等待时间,加快开发进度
2、提升软件质量:多个智能体可分别执行多轮自动化测试、智能迭代等工作,保证开发质量
3、提高灵活性:智能体根据环境变化和用户需求,动态调整策略,提高系统灵活性。
下面以捷码智为例,介绍智能体协同工作的场景。捷码智是远眺科技自研的一款AI源代码生成工具,能实现原型高效设计、系统智能生成、源代码直接修改。
首先,产品经理或项目经理可通过捷码智内置的原型工具,以可视化的方式,快速完成应用界面的搭建,通过自然语言生成实现各组件描述的功能。
其次,完成原型需求描述后。捷码智会调用多个针对性训练的大型语言模型Agent,例如需求理解Agent、数据库设计Agent、后端开发Agent和前端开发Agent等,协同工作,自动生成包括管理、监测、分析等模块在内的完整后端Java语言和前端Vue框架的软件项目级源代码。
最后,捷码智内置的试Agent会执行多轮自动化测试,快速发现潜在的代码缺陷。系统会将测试结果反馈给LLM,进行智能修正和迭代,确保生成的代码高质量、低错误率。
同时,用捷码智搭建好的项目支持源代码修改,实现源代码直接交付。
更多捷码系列产品信息以及远眺科技成功项目信息,欢迎到远眺科技官网: www.gemcoder.com
Agent 智能体赋能软件开发:看捷码・智如何高效提升效率与智能化水平? 阅读514次
智慧停车场系统简介:远眺科技赋能打造高效、便捷停车体验 阅读774次
捷码AI智能体,打造软件开发超级生产力! 阅读906次
点击“立即申请”即可成为捷码客户,将享受捷码终身技术咨询服务,和远程技术支持服务。